New York, Farrar, Straus, Giroux, 1983.. FIRST AMERICAN EDITION 1983 (stated first edition), 4to, 285 x 220 mm, 11¼ x 8¾ inches, maroon cloth, gilt lettered spine, no pagination. 10 superb colour plates and other black and white text illustrations by Rosemary Fawcett. No inscriptions, head and tail of spine just slightly bumped, contents perfect. Near Fine in VG+ DUSTWRAPPER (dw: not priced clipped ($11.95), head and tail of spine very slightly worn, 2 mm (1/10") chip to surface colour at tail, a couple of 5 mm (¼") closed tears to top edge, 10 mm closed tear to lower edge of lower panel). Published the same year by Cape in the U.K. See Treglown page 221: 'Dahl himself hated the drawings.' He apparently offered to incinerate all unsold copies and dance around the bonfire. Synopsis
Roald Dahl's inimitable style and humor shine in this collection of poems about mischievous and mysterious animals. From Stingaling the scorpion to Crocky-Wock the crocodile, Dahl's animals are nothing short of ridiculous. A clever pig with an unmentionable plan to save his own bacon and an anteater with an unusually large appetite are among the characters created by Dahl in these timeless rhymes. This new, larger edition is perfect for reading aloud and makes Quentin Blake's celebrated illustrations even more enjoyable. "Will elicit a loud 'Yuck.' In other words, children will love them." ( Children's Book Review Service )
